    I am a Klaviyo Silver partner and a one-man band at Pixels and Clicks and I work with small and mid-level DTC/eCommerce brands to:

    • Work out an email strategy that keeps in mind the brand story, the industry dynamics, and most importantly, consumer needs ( I use jobs-to-be-done framework for this)
    • Set up the important email flows that your store needs, write the copy and run A/B tests
    • Also work on different campaigns
    • Run regular reporting and analytics so that performance can be improved.

    While I am a power Canva user and experienced in conversion centered design, I prefer to leave the design part of emails with people who are much better at that job than me.

    When in doubt, embrace flows over campaigns. Automated flows are a money spinner (check out this post based on Klaviypo data)

    I prefer working with clients for at least a few months as an integral part of their team so that I can understand their business, their customers and the market. 

    I am proficient at research, and there’s no topic that I can’t break down: I started my career as a B2B copywriter working to make high tech companies sound more business friendly on the internet. 

    I have also launched brands, designed sites and landing pages and can give you deep insights on how to optimize your landing pages, sign up forms or checkout for a higher conversion rate

    I am looking forward to helping brands realize the crazy profit potential of email, so that they don’t have to depend on capricious social media or search algorithms for their revenue.
